myWiFi Key is a simple and lightweight utility designed to help you retrieve saved WiFi passwords on your device. If you’ve connected to a wireless network in the past but forgotten the password, this application provides an easy way to access it again without digging through settings or resetting your router.
It works with networks across all router brands and is suited for users of all experience levels, including beginners.
The moment you launch myWiFi Key, it scans your system for all stored WiFi profiles and extracts the corresponding passwords. These are displayed alongside the network names (SSIDs), making it quick and simple to identify the connection you need. You don’t need any technical knowledge, and the process is almost entirely automated.
Even if you can’t remember when you last used a network, the tool can still locate and show the saved key—so long as your system has the profile saved.
One of the most appealing aspects of myWiFi Key is its minimal footprint. It takes up very little space and doesn’t slow down your system. The interface is extremely straightforward, designed as a preview-only screen that shows available WiFi keys without offering a complex menu system or configuration settings.
Because of its simplicity, it’s ideal for users who need a quick password reminder without wanting to dive into router admin pages or system folders.
Although the application does a good job displaying stored WiFi credentials, it’s limited in interactivity. You can’t modify or copy the password for future use directly from the app. It also doesn’t provide options for editing network settings or managing connections, focusing purely on showing what’s already stored.
The lack of an options menu or export functionality means that while helpful in the moment, its use is limited to on-screen viewing only.
